Pastel colours such as soft pink, soft yellow or light lavender can create a soft and calming atmosphere in the bedroom. These colours are subtle and soft, which helps to brighten up the room without being too overpowering. Pastel colours are often associated with lightness, freshness and softness, which can contribute to a peaceful sleeping environment. And if you don't like it quite so colourful, almost all pastel shades can also be ideally combined with grey. Because grey is also good for the bedroom and forms a nice contrast to the pastel shades while still radiating a pleasant warmth.
Grey is a versatile colour that comes in various shades from light grey to anthracite. Grey can create an elegant and calm atmosphere in a bedroom. Light shades of grey appear airy and light, while darker shades of grey can convey a sense of depth and security. Grey is often associated with neutrality, balance and stability, which can support a relaxing environment for a good night's sleep.
White is a classic colour for bedrooms as it symbolises purity, clarity and freshness. White walls can open up the room and convey a feeling of space and lightness. White reflects the light and makes the room brighter, which can have a calming effect.

Hence our tip: white allows for versatility in decoration and allows other colours and textures in the room to come into their own. White should therefore be used in combination rather than on its own.
